For this card i first stamped this gorgeous butterfly by Tubby Crafts with alcohol marker friendly ink (you can use Memento Tuxedo Black or Tubby Crafty Jet Black) on a white card stock (Use an alcohol marker firendly card stock like Nennah Solar White).

WNXS0756.JPG

I then colored the image with copic markers and then fussy cut the image leaving a whtite background all around. I then cut two die cuts from the letter “M” using the bold Alphabet dies by Die cuts and more. I also die cut two “M”s out of a craft sheet and then adhered to the paper die cuts.

LCYB1481.JPG

On a card front which I die cut using wonky rectangle die by Avery elle, I adhered both the die cuts of the letter “M” which already had the foam cuts underneath. And in middle of both the letters I adhered the butterfly with foam squares to match the dimention. I lifted the wings of the butterfly for added interest and more dimenson.

LHER2296.JPG

I then added the “i love you ‘ sentiement by MFT Stamps in black to finish the card before adhering it to a card base.

For my card I first stamped these adorable image of the rainbow with clouds and unicorn from the ‘Be a Unicorn’ stampset by Avery Elle on to nenah solar white cardstock (Copic friendly paper) with black memento ink (Copic friendly ink) and colored with copics lovely rainbow colors. I then die cut the images with the coordinating dies.

bharati nayudu Rainbow2 unicorn CAS Card with avery elle stamps for AAA Cards.jpgI then die cut two windows in a white card front and stamped the sentiment from the same stamp set. I ink blended a panel with distress inks in such a way that they form the background for the window openings, which i adhered to the card front with foam tape for dimension.

I finally adhered the colored images with foam squared inside the windows. As a finishing touch I added two hearts near the sentiment. I then adhered the whole panel to a white card base.

In case of my card, using the windows helped my maximize the empty space for a CAS look. I love the burst of colors against the white. That’s, i think, is the best part of rainbow theme with a CAS design.

Its a new year and i wanted to try something new. This is one of my first cards with alcohol inks . I used Ranger Adirondack alcohol inks & mixatives. By the way, I made a DIY alcohol blender by mixing surgical spirit with just few drops of glycerin. This seems to be working well for me. The inks are addictive to play with as the results are very unique each time and the process is super fun.

I die cut the butterflies from an alcohol ink panel. I tried a splatter of silver mixative on black card stock – I have to tell you, it felt good doing it (please note that the mixative takes quite some time to dry). I then adhered only the body of butterflies, leaving their wings free for dimension, before adding with foam tape the white heat embossed sentiment on match black card stock strips. To finish the card, I adhered the card panel at angle for added interest and just to try out something new.

Picture2.pngTo make with card i stamped the images from My Favorite things – Growing up stampset with memento black ink on neenah solar white card stock and colored those with my copic markers. I added the white highlights with a white gel pen. The images were then cut using the coordinating dies.

Then i made a white gate fold card base ready by scoring a 6 x 10 white cardstock from both edges.  Using the coordinating die for the image of the big hot air balloon, the window aligning both the folds was cut in such a way that it matched the placement of the hot air balloon in the center panel inside the card.

Next I took three white cardstock panels and die cut these with a stitched rectangle die. I inked the first panel to create a scene with a night sky by ink blending distress oxide inks and then adding white splatters with gesso. I cut this night sky panel to match the window and the gate fold cut on the card base and stuck it to the form the front of the cardbase after adding the sentiment and sticking the colored die cut images.

Picture3.pngIn the next step i ink blended some clouds with distress oxide ink on the remaining two panels to create a day scene. One of the panels was cut to match the inside of the window and the gate fold card base and stuck it on inside of both the folds of the card base. The remaining panel will form the center for the inside of the card. On this panel i first black heat embossed the sentiment and then die cut the gap for slider action. I then added the big hot air balloon in the slider panel in such a way that it fit the window that was already cut in the gate fold card and stuck this panel using foam tape. There are many tutorials online on assembling slider cards, you may want to check out those.

IMG-20171124-WA0022

Once the slider was working, I added the grass landscapes that i had made by die cutting ink blended pieces with different green distress oxide inks. To finish the card i added cute little images that i had colored and die cut earlier.
